Swap tiers, rules, or defaults at runtime. |\n\n## Usage\n\n### Basic middleware\n\n```ts\nimport { rateLimit, MemoryStore, SlidingWindowStrategy } from \"@acbp/rate-limiter\"\n\nconst store = new MemoryStore()\nconst strategy = new SlidingWindowStrategy(store)\n\napp.use(rateLimit({ store, strategy, maxHits: 100, windowMs: 60_000 }))\n```\n\n### Per-plan limits\n\nUse `resolveLimits` for per-request limits, or `TierResolver` for a declarative config map:\n\n```ts\nimport { TierResolver, rateLimit } from \"@acbp/rate-limiter\"\n\nconst resolver = new TierResolver({\n  tiers: {\n    free:  { maxHits: 10,  windowMs: 60_000 },\n    pro:   { maxHits: 100, windowMs: 60_000 },\n  },\n  defaultLimits: { maxHits: 50, windowMs: 60_000 },\n  resolveTier: (req) => req.headers[\"x-plan\"] ?? \"free\",\n})\n\napp.use(\"/api\", rateLimit({\n  resolveLimits: (req) => resolver.resolveLimits(req),\n}))\n\nresolver.setConfig({ tiers: { free: { maxHits: 5, windowMs: 60_000 } }, ... })\n```\n\n### Declarative rules\n\nFirst-match-wins. Fine-grained control by path, method, tier, or custom function:\n\n```ts\napp.use(rateLimit({\n  store, strategy,\n  rules: [\n    { match: { path: \"/login\", method: \"POST\", tier: \"free\" }, maxHits: 3,   windowMs: 60_000 },\n    { match: { path: \"/login\", method: \"POST\", tier: \"pro\" },  maxHits: 30,  windowMs: 60_000 },\n    { match: { path: \"/api/\" }, maxHits: 50, windowMs: 60_000 },\n    { match: { match: (req) => req.ip === \"192.168.1.1\" }, maxHits: 1000, windowMs: 60_000 },\n  ],\n  resolveTier: (req) => req.headers[\"x-plan\"] ?? \"free\",\n  resolveLimits: (req) => resolver.resolveLimits(req),\n}))\n```\n\n- No trailing slash (e.g. `/login`) = exact path match\n- Trailing slash (e.g. `/api/`) = prefix match\n- Rules evaluated before `resolveLimits`, before global defaults\n\n### Weighted cost\n\nEvery request counts as 1 by default. Set `cost` at any level to make a request count more:\n\n```ts\n// Global cost — all requests on this route consume 5 units\napp.use(\"/batch\", rateLimit({ maxHits: 15, windowMs: 60_000, cost: 5 }))\n\n// Dynamic cost from resolveLimits\napp.use(\"/api\", rateLimit({\n  resolveLimits: (req) => ({\n    maxHits: 100, windowMs: 60_000,\n    cost: req.method === \"POST\" ? 3 : 1,\n  }),\n}))\n\n// Cost from rules\napp.use(\"/api\", rateLimit({\n  rules: [\n    { match: { path: \"/api/upload\" }, maxHits: 10, windowMs: 60_000, cost: 10 },\n    { match: { path: \"/api/\" }, maxHits: 100, windowMs: 60_000 },\n  ],\n}))\n```\n\nCost is clamped to a minimum of 1. With `cost: 5` and `maxHits: 15`, you can send 3 requests before blocking.\n\n### Monitoring events\n\n```ts\nconst limiter = new RateLimiter({ store, strategy })\n\nlimiter.events.on(\"rate-limit:check\", (e) => {\n  console.log(`${e.allowed ? \"ALLOW\" : \"BLOCK\"} ${e.key} (${e.totalHits}/${e.maxHits})`)\n})\n\nlimiter.events.on(\"rate-limit:blocked\", (e) => {\n  console.log(`429 SENT to ${e.key}`)\n  sendAlert(e)                              // your own alerting\n})\n```\n\nEvents fire asynchronously via `process.nextTick` — zero overhead on the hot path.\n\n### Store error handling\n\nControl behaviour when the storage backend fails:\n\n```ts\napp.use(rateLimit({\n  store: new RedisStore(client),\n  strategy: new SlidingWindowStrategy(store),\n  maxHits: 100,\n  windowMs: 60_000,\n  onStoreError: \"allow\",    // default — let the request through\n  // onStoreError: \"block\", // return 429 on store failure\n}))\n```\n\nWhen a store error occurs, the limiter emits a `rate-limit:error` event so you can monitor:\n\n```ts\nlimiter.events.on(\"rate-limit:error\", (e) => {\n  console.error(\"Rate limiter store failure:\", e)\n  sendAlert(e)\n})\n```\n\n### Framework adapters\n\nThe core handler is framework-agnostic. For other frameworks, use `createRateLimitHandler`:\n\n```ts\nimport { createRateLimitHandler } from \"@acbp/rate-limiter\"\n\nconst handler = createRateLimitHandler({ maxHits: 100, windowMs: 60_000 })\n\n// Works with any framework:\nconst result = await handler(request)\n// result: { allowed, headers, statusCode?, body? }\n```\n\nSee [docs/community-adapters.md](docs/community-adapters.md) for the full contract.\n\n## Security\n\nSecurity is a first-class concern. Here's what rate-limiter does out of the box:\n\n### Input validation\n\nAll public API surfaces (`RateLimiter`, `createRateLimitHandler`, `rateLimit`) validate inputs at construction time. `maxHits`, `windowMs`, and `cost` must be positive finite numbers. `Infinity`, `NaN`, `0`, and negative values throw a `TypeError`.\n\nCost values are additionally clamped to a minimum of 1 at runtime via `Math.max(1, cost)`, protecting against `resolveLimits` or rule code that might return bad values.\n\n### Graceful store degradation\n\nWhen the storage backend (Redis, etc.) fails, you choose the behaviour:\n- **`onStoreError: \"allow\"`** (default) — requests pass through as if no limit was hit. Your API stays up.\n- **`onStoreError: \"block\"`** — requests receive a 429 response. Rate limits are enforced, even when the store is down.\n\nA `rate-limit:error` event fires in both cases so you can alert, log, or trigger failover.\n\n### Atomic Redis increments\n\nRedisStore uses a Lua script (`EVAL`) for atomic read-increment-write operations inside the sliding window. This eliminates TOCTOU race conditions under concurrent load (multiple requests arriving in the same millisecond).\n\nThe script is passed to Redis via the `EVAL` command — atomic by design, requiring Redis ≥ 2.6.\n\n### Prototype pollution defense\n\nThe `TierResolver` guards tier lookups with `Object.hasOwn(tiers, tier)` before bracket access, preventing prototype-pollution attacks via tier names like `__proto__`, `constructor`, or `prototype`. Resolved limits are shallow-copied before return to prevent mutation of the stored configuration.\n\n### Event listener isolation\n\nEvent listeners are fire-and-forget via `process.nextTick` and wrapped in `try/catch`. A throwing listener will never crash the process.\n\n### Minimum Node.js version\n\nRequires **Node.js ≥ 20.19.2**. This minimum patches several CVEs:\n- **CVE-2024-27982** — HTTP/2 CONTINUATION flood DoS\n- **CVE-2025-23167** — HTTP request smuggling via llhttp\n\nUsing an older version exposes your application to these known vulnerabilities.\n\n### Key safety\n\nRequest keys are capped at 1024 characters to prevent memory exhaustion from oversized identifiers. Rate limiter instances that receive requests without an identifiable IP fall back to a unique `unknown:<randomUUID>` key per instance, preventing accidental cross-instance rate limiting.\n\n## API\n\n### `rateLimit(options)`\n\nExpress middleware.
